From The Daily GazetteBy John Cropley | February 1, 2021 SCHENECTADY — Schenectady-based routing software company Transfinder announced its 23rd consecutive year of revenue growth. The $18.9 million in revenue — a 13% increase over 2019 — came amid the COVID crisis and the widespread shutdown of schools, potentially a damaging situation for a company that relies on school bus fleet operators for most of its business.
